Passa al contenuto principale
Supporto OCLC

Caricamento dei dati degli avventori in formato tab-delimitato

Questa documentazione spiega i requisiti per i file di dati degli assistenti, le regole e i requisiti per l'invio dei dati degli assistenti in formato tab-delimitato e fornisce un modello per il vostro file di dati degli assistenti.
File Descrizione
Modello di dati degli avventori delimitato da tabelle (Microsoft Excel) Contiene 46 colonne. Salvare come file di testo delimitato da tabelle (non è possibile utilizzare un file Excel per inviare i dati).

Colonne

Utilizzare i seguenti criteri per creare colonne per i dati:

  • Il file di testo deve contenere tutte le 46 colonne delimitate da tabelle nell'ordine elencato nella tabella seguente.
  • La prima riga del file di testo è l'intestazione e deve contenere i nomi delle colonne separati da tabulazioni.
  • I nomi delle intestazioni delle colonne non sono sensibili alle maiuscole e alle minuscole, ma devono essere scritti correttamente.
  • Ogni riga del file delimitato da tabulazione deve contenere 45 caratteri di tabulazione, che fungono da separatori di colonna.
  • Tutti i valori delle colonne sono stringhe (stringhe di testo, stringhe numeriche, ecc.).
  • Se non si hanno dati da inserire in una colonna, lasciarla vuota.

Nome del file

La denominazione dei file deve seguire regole specifiche:

  • I nomi dei file possono contenere lettere, numeri, punti e trattini bassi.
  • I nomi dei file non possono contenere spazi o caratteri speciali.
  • Se si utilizza un computer non Windows, salvare il file come file di testo in formato Windows.

Esempio: OCLCsymbolpatrons.txt

Inviare i dati dell'utente

Una volta preparati i dati, inviare i file dei dati dei patroni via SFTP con il proprio account di scambio file OCLC.

Elenco Usato per
/xfer/wms/test/in/patron

Dati in fase di valutazione per il caricamento automatico dei dati

 Nota: Per garantire che il vostro file di prova sia gestito in modo appropriato, informate il supporto OCLC dopo aver caricato un file nella directory di prova e fornite una spiegazione dell'analisi richiesta.

/xfer/wms/in/patron Dati approvati per il caricamento automatico dei dati

Aggiornamenti continui del carico di clienti

  • Se in un record di aggiornamento sono inclusi nuovi dati, tutti saranno sostituiti con le nuove informazioni. Questo non si applica ai campi sourceSystem/idAtSource. Se questi campi vengono modificati, viene aggiunta una nuova voce nell'accordion del conto.
  • Le informazioni sul nome e sull'indirizzo postale vengono trattate come un gruppo; se in precedenza esisteva un indirizzo completo e il record di aggiornamento include solo il paese, l'indirizzo postale verrà sovrascritto con il solo paese. Se nel record di aggiornamento non viene fornito nulla di nuovo, viene mantenuto il vecchio indirizzo.
  • Se un record di aggiornamento non include dati per un campo opzionale, ma conteneva dati in un aggiornamento precedente, i dati originali saranno mantenuti.
  • Se si desidera eliminare in blocco i record degli avventori della biblioteca, vedere Eliminazione in blocco di dati delimitati da tabelle.
  Campi Azione
Per WorldShare Circulation, se è presente uno dei seguenti campi > codice a barre, homeBranch, borrowerCategory, circRegistrationDate > Verrà trattato come un record di WorldShare Circulation e si presuppone che i campi obbligatori di WorldShare Circulation siano presenti.
Per Tipasa, se è presente uno qualsiasi dei campi ILL > illId, illApprovalStatus, illPatronType, illPickupLocation > Verrà trattato come un record ILL e si presuppone che i campi obbligatori ILL siano presenti.
Per la Circolazione WorldShare, se manca uno dei campi obbligatori della Circolazione WorldShare > givenName OR familyName, institutionId, barcode, borrowerCategory, homeBranch, > Il record verrà ignorato.
Per Tipasa, se manca qualche campo > givenName OR familyName, institutionId, illId, almeno una informazione di contatto (indirizzo postale, telefono o e-mail) > Il record verrà ignorato.
Se sono presenti entrambi i campi WorldShare Circulation e Tipasa >   Si occuperà dei requisiti per entrambi i tipi di registri.

Campi del record

Colonne 1-17

Colonna
numero

Nome della colonna Richiesto per
Biblioteche con circolazione WorldShare
Richiesto per
Biblioteche Tipasa
Descrizione Limite di caratteri
1 prefisso Opzionale Opzionale
  1. Prefisso o titolo, come Ms, Dr, Sir.
254
2 nome dato

Richiesto

è richiesto il nome di battesimo o il nome di famiglia

Richiesto

è richiesto il nome di battesimo o il nome di famiglia

  1. Nome del committente.
  2. è richiesto il nome del cognome o il nome della famiglia.
50
3 nome medio Opzionale Opzionale
  1. Secondo nome del committente.
100
4 nome famiglia

Richiesto

è richiesto il nome di battesimo o il nome di famiglia

Richiesto

è richiesto il nome di battesimo o il nome di famiglia

  1. Cognome del committente.
  2. è richiesto il nome del cognome o il nome della famiglia.
50
5 suffisso Opzionale Opzionale
  1. Un indicatore di generazione come Jr, III, e/o un epiteto come PhD, FRS.
254
6 soprannome Opzionale Opzionale
  1. Nome alternativo, non include saluti o epiteti come PhD.
  2. Non viene visualizzato nel record del patrono, ma è indicizzato per la ricerca.
50
7 puòAuto-modificarsi Opzionale Opzionale
  1. Indica che l'utente può gestire il nome da solo per funzionalità future.
  2. Permette i valori di:
    Vero
    Falso
  3. Il valore predefinito è false.
 
8 dataDellaNascita Opzionale Opzionale
  1. Data di nascita nel formato anno-mese-giorno: AAAA-MM-GG
 
9 genere Opzionale Opzionale
  1. Se presente, deve contenere uno dei seguenti valori:
    Femmina o F
    Maschio o M
    Sconosciuto o U
     

     Nota: tutti i valori sono insensibili alle maiuscole e alle minuscole.

  2. Il valore predefinito è Sconosciuto se lasciato vuoto.
 
10 istituzioneId Richiesto Richiesto
  1. L'institutionId (alias ID del registro WorldCat) è un identificativo unico di una biblioteca.
  2. I gruppi sono supportati consentendo alle biblioteche di inviare un file in institutionIds.
  3. L'institutionId è fornito dal vostro OCLC Implementation Manager o può essere trovato utilizzando una ricerca per simbolo di istituzione (identificatori).
 
11 codice a barre Richiesto Non applicabile (il codice a barre può essere inviato come illId)
  1. Solo funzionalità di WorldShare Circulation.
  2. Un identificatore unico per ogni cliente.
  3. Può contenere lettere o numeri.
  4. Gli spazi all'interno della stringa del codice a barre sono accettabili, ma gli spazi iniziali e finali sono problematici.
  5. La corrispondenza degli aggiornamenti degli avventori inizia con idAtSource e sourceSystem (se forniti) e poi con il codice a barre.
  6. Per ulteriori informazioni, vedere Riferimento al file di dati del patrono.
20
12 idAtSource

Opzionale

Richiesto se si utilizza un sistema di autenticazione non OCL.

Opzionale

Richiesto se si utilizza un sistema di autenticazione non OCLC

  1.  ID di un utente nel sistema esterno (ad es. ILS, PeopleSoft, Banner, CAS) da cui vengono migrati i dati.
  2. Se il sistema non è sensibile alle maiuscole e minuscole, queste devono essere uniche e in minuscolo.
  3. Se presente, deve essere presente anche sourceSystem.
  4. Per ulteriori informazioni, vedere Riferimento al file di dati del patrono.
50
13 sistema sorgente

Opzionale

Richiesto se si utilizza un sistema di autenticazione non OCL.

Opzionale

Richiesto se si utilizza un sistema di autenticazione non OCL.

  1. URN che identifica il sistema di autenticazione esterno (ad es. urn:mace:oclc:idm:testlibrary.ldap).
  2. Fornito da OCLC (ad es. LDAP) o dell'istituzione (ad es. Shibboleth).
  3. Se presente, deve essere presente anche idAtSource.
  4. Per ulteriori informazioni, vedere Riferimento al file di dati del patrono.
255
14 mutuatarioCategoria Richiesto Non applicabile (può essere utilizzato illPatronType)
  1. Solo per la funzionalità WorldShare Circulation.
  2. Categoria di prestatore (tipo di cliente) fornita dalla biblioteca.
  3. Utilizzato per impostare i criteri di circolazione.
  4. I nuovi valori possono essere forniti nei file di aggiornamento dei patroni e aggiunti nella configurazione del servizio OCLC.
  5. Esempi: Studente, Adulto, Facoltà, Personale, ecc.
30
15 data di registrazione Opzionale Non applicabile
  1. Solo funzionalità WMS.

  2. Data di creazione dell'account del patrono.

  3. Utilizzare questo formato per la data:
    AAAA-MM-GG 2016-12-31

  4. Se non viene fornita alcuna data, per impostazione predefinita verrà aggiunta la data in cui il record è stato aggiunto.

 

16

oclcData di scadenza Opzionale Opzionale
  1. Se si utilizza l'autenticazione di base di WorldShare, la data in cui scade l'accesso a determinati servizi forniti da OCLC; dopo questa data l'utente non sarà più autenticato né autorizzato a utilizzare servizi quali la circolazione o l'ILL. Nota: se si utilizza l'autenticazione di terzi (ad esempio, LDAP/CAS/SAML), questo campo non ha alcun effetto. 
  2. Utilizzare questo formato di data e ora:
    AAAA-MM-DDThh:mm:ss
    2016-12-31T00:00:00
  3. Se non è stato configurato un periodo di scadenza predefinito, non apparirà alcuna data di scadenza.
  4. Se è stato configurato un periodo di scadenza predefinito, ma non è stata fornita alcuna data, la data di scadenza sarà impostata su 60 mesi (cinque anni) per impostazione predefinita.
  5. Se viene incluso un componente temporale, questo verrà scartato poiché oclcExpirationDate viene memorizzato come una data senza componente temporale.
  6. Se presente, questa data può anche essere utilizzata da WorldShare Circulation per calcolare la data di scadenza degli articoli durante il checkout.
 
17 homeBranch Richiesto Non applicabile
  1. Solo per la funzionalità WorldShare Circulation.
  2. ID della filiale di provenienza del cliente, che è un codice numerico (non il codice della biblioteca di deposito).
  3. Gli ID delle filiali sono forniti dal responsabile dell'implementazione di OCLC.
  4. Questo valore si trova nella Configurazione del servizio OCLC > WorldCat Discovery e WorldCat Local > Tabella di traduzione dei codici dei possedimenti
 

 

Colonne 18-35

Colonna
numero

Nome della colonna Richiesto per
Biblioteche con circolazione WorldShare
Richiesto per
Biblioteche Tipasa
Descrizione Limite di caratteri
È richiesto almeno un dato di contatto, indirizzo postale, e-mail o numero di telefono.
18 primaryStreetAddressLine1 Opzionale Opzionale
  1. Indirizzo stradale primario riga 1.
120
19 primaryStreetAddressLine2 Opzionale Opzionale
  1. Indirizzo stradale principale riga 2, se applicabile.
120
20 città o località primaria Opzionale Opzionale
  1. Città o località principale.
50
21 Stato o Provincia primaria Opzionale Opzionale
  1. Stato o provincia principale.
  2. Per gli Stati americani, utilizzare le abbreviazioni dello United States Post Office.
120
22 codice postale primario Opzionale Opzionale
  1. Codice postale primario degli Stati Uniti o codice postale non statunitense.
20
23 paese primario Opzionale Opzionale
  1. Paese primario.
  2. Non abbreviare. Usare Stati Uniti, non Stati Uniti d'America o USA.
120
24 telefono primario Opzionale Opzionale
  1. Numero di telefono principale.
  2. Può essere utilizzato qualsiasi formato.
50
25 secondaryStreetAddressLine1 Opzionale Opzionale
  1. Indirizzo secondario riga 1.
120
26 secondaryStreetAddressLine2 Opzionale Opzionale
  1. Riga dell'indirizzo secondario 2.
120
27 città o località secondaria Opzionale Opzionale
  1. Città o località secondaria.
50
28 Stato o provincia secondaria Opzionale Opzionale
  1. Stato o provincia secondaria.
  2. Per gli Stati americani, utilizzare le abbreviazioni dello United States Post Office.
120
29 codice postale secondario Opzionale Opzionale
  1. Codice postale statunitense secondario o codice postale non statunitense.
20
30 paese secondario Opzionale Opzionale
  1. Paese secondario.
  2. Non abbreviare. Usare Stati Uniti, non Stati Uniti d'America o USA.
120
31 telefono secondario Opzionale Opzionale
  1. Numero di telefono secondario.
50
32 Indirizzo e-mail Opzionale Opzionale
  1. Per l'accesso dei patroni tramite l'autenticazione OCLC è necessario un indirizzo e-mail.
  2. Per i clienti senza indirizzo e-mail, è meglio fornire un valore predefinito (si può usare qualsiasi valore).
254
33 telefono cellulare Opzionale Opzionale
  1. Numero di telefono cellulare.
50
34 notificaEmail Non applicabile Opzionale
  1. Solo funzionalità Tipasa.
4,096
35 notificationTextPhone Non applicabile

Opzionale

 Nota: se un numero di cellulare è presente in questo campo e non viene convalidato, il carico del patrono verrà rifiutato.

  1. Solo funzionalità Tipasa.
  2. È richiesto il formato internazionale completo, compreso il codice del paese (ad es. +1 232-456-5678 per un numero statunitense, +44 20 4961 5678 per un numero britannico o +61 (0) 3 9929 0800 per un numero australiano). Per ulteriori informazioni, vedere Notazione dei numeri di telefono, degli indirizzi e-mail e degli indirizzi web nazionali e internazionali.
4,096

 

Colonne 36-46

Colonna
numero

Nome della colonna Richiesto per
Biblioteche con circolazione WorldShare
Richiesto per
Biblioteche Tipasa
Descrizione Limite di caratteri
36 patronoNote Opzionale Opzionale
  1. Le note provenienti da carichi di dati in corso che sono identiche a quelle caricate in precedenza vengono ignorate.
  2. Vengono aggiunte le note dei carichi di dati in corso che non sono identiche alle note caricate in precedenza.
255
37 photoURL Opzionale Opzionale
  1. Un URL che visualizza o rimanda alla foto dell'utente.
  2. La foto viene visualizzata nel profilo del cliente nei moduli WorldShare Admin e Circulation.
  3. OCLC non archivia attualmente foto.
  4. L'istituzione può garantire la sicurezza della foto ospitandola su un server sicuro. Consultate le politiche del vostro istituto in materia di sicurezza dei file fotografici collegati.
8,192
38 dati personalizzati1 Opzionale Opzionale
  1. Può corrispondere a valori predefiniti in OCLC Service Configuration o essere un testo libero (non inserito in OCLC Service Configuration).
  2. I campi di dati personalizzati provenienti da carichi di dati in corso che non sono identici ai campi caricati in precedenza sostituiscono il valore caricato in precedenza.
  3. I campi di dati personalizzati provenienti da carichi di dati in corso che sono identici ai campi caricati in precedenza vengono ignorati.
  4. I campi di dati personalizzati lasciati vuoti nei carichi di dati in corso vengono ignorati e viene mantenuto il valore precedente, se esistente.
  5. I campi dati personalizzati possono essere eliminati nei moduli WorldShare Admin o Circulation.
8,192
39 dati personalizzati2 Opzionale Opzionale
40 dati personalizzati3 Opzionale Opzionale
41 customdata4 Opzionale Opzionale
42 nome utente Opzionale Opzionale
  1. È il nome di accesso dell'utente da utilizzare solo per l'autenticazione gestita da OCLC.
  2. Questo deve essere fornito solo se l'istituzione non utilizza il codice a barre come nome utente.
  3. A seconda della configurazione dell'istituto, il codice a barre e il nome utente possono essere collegati.
  4. Ignorato se l'autenticazione è effettuata dall'istituzione o da una terza parte (nel qual caso OCLC non memorizza le credenziali di accesso).
  5. Deve essere unico.
50
43 illId Non applicabile Richiesto
  1. Solo funzionalità Tipasa.
  2. Un identificativo unico per l'utente nel sistema Tipasa.
  3. Può essere, ma non necessariamente, il codice a barre della biblioteca dell'utente.

     Nota: l'integrazione WMS Circ-Tipasa funziona solo se l'illld dell'utente e il valore del codice a barre sono gli stessi.

  4. Per ulteriori informazioni, vedere Riferimento al file di dati del patrono.
254
44 illApprovalStatus Non applicabile Opzionale
  1. Solo funzionalità Tipasa.
  2. Consente alle biblioteche di pre-approvare o bloccare gli avventori per Tipasa tramite il carico degli avventori o di modificare lo stato di approvazione degli avventori per Tipasa.
  3. I valori supportati sono:
    Nuovo
    Approvato
    Bloccato
  4. Se il valore viene lasciato vuoto al primo caricamento di un patrono e nel file del patrono è presente un valore illId, il valore predefinito verrà impostato su "New".
  5. Se il valore viene lasciato vuoto negli aggiornamenti dei patroni esistenti, verrà mantenuto il valore esistente impostato nel database.
 
45 illPatronType Non applicabile Opzionale
  1. Solo funzionalità Tipasa.
  2. Questo valore viene inserito automaticamente nel campo Stato dei moduli di lavoro delle richieste dei clienti se i valori dei campi sono configurati in modo da corrispondere ai valori inviati nei record dei dati dei clienti.
  3. Se il campo dello stato del patrono è incluso nei moduli di richiesta del patrono, i dati di illPatronType vengono acquisiti nelle statistiche di utilizzo di ILL.
50
46 illPickupLocation Non applicabile Opzionale
  1. This value will automatically populate in the Pickup Location field on Patron Request Workforms.
  2. Se una biblioteca ha più sedi, è consigliabile utilizzare per illPickupLocation nel carico degli avventori gli stessi valori utilizzati nei moduli di richiesta degli avventori.
1,000

Rapporti di elaborazione del file dei dati dei clienti

I rapporti sui dati degli utenti sono disponibili nella directory di scambio file wms/reports e possono essere scaricati utilizzando un client SFTP open-source o utilizzando i comandi SFTP.

Questa tabella mostra le directory per il download di file e rapporti.

Tipo di file Posizione della directory dei file SFTP Nota
Rapporto di eccezione per i clienti /xfer/wms/report Elenca i record degli avventori che non sono stati caricati nel WMS e il motivo del fallimento. Il rapporto di eccezione viene eseguito solo se c'è almeno un record di cliente che non è riuscito a essere caricato in WMS all'interno di un file di cliente.
Rapporto di riepilogo dei clienti /xfer/wms/report Viene eseguito dopo che un file di patroni è stato caricato nel WMS e indica quanti patroni nel file sono stati letti, elaborati, buoni (caricati), cattivi (non caricati), nuovi e aggiornati.